Mortal Kombat Mobile Marks 10 Years with New Diamond, Gold Characters

Mortal Kombat Mobile is celebrating a major milestone—its 10th anniversary! Warner Bros International and NetherRealm Studios are pulling out all the stops with a massive update set to launch on March 25th. This celebration brings exciting new fighters, a reimagined Faction Wars mode, fresh challenge towers, and an abundance of anniversary-themed rewards for players to enjoy.

Celebrate A Decade Of Unrelenting Combat

The centerpiece of this update is the arrival of MK1 Geras, a powerful diamond-tier fighter who introduces a versatile combat style. With abilities such as power absorption, healing, and damage reflection, Geras promises to be a valuable addition to your roster. To unlock him, you’ll need to complete Realm Klash objectives or progress through the Kombat Pass.

Joining him is Klassic Skarlet, the first gold-tier fighter capable of reaching Level 5 ascension. Her skillset includes unblockable attacks, the unique Gash debuff, and the ability to steal blood droplets from opponents. She can be obtained via the Premium Plus Kombat Pass or earned through the standard version.

Realm Klash Replaces Faction Wars

Faction Wars has undergone a full transformation and now returns as Realm Klash. Instead of merely collecting Blood Rubies, players can now choose from five distinct realms and compete in two-week seasonal cycles to earn Realm Points. The mode also features visual enhancements, updated banners, improved leaderboards, and bug fixes that ensure a more balanced experience.

New ranks have been introduced: Elder God, God, and Demi God. These additions provide additional progression depth and prestige. Additionally, Blood Ruby Packs now include exclusive Kameo options and MK1 Geras-themed content.

New Challenges And Tower Of Time

The 10th Anniversary update also introduces the limited-time Tower of Time, running for two weeks and featuring 50 intense floors of combat. Alongside this, seven new Tower of Time equipment pieces become available for collection.

MK1 Smoke and MK1 Geras each receive their own Brutality equipment sets, enhancing their battlefield dominance. A Fusion Boost modifier has also been added, granting a power boost to your team’s lowest fused card to create a more balanced challenge.

In addition to the new tower, classic towers like the Klassic Tower, Dark Queen’s Tower, and Black Dragon Tower return for fans to relive past challenges with updated mechanics and rewards.

Free Anniversary Rewards Await

Starting April 1st, players will receive a free copy of each featured anniversary character every day for ten consecutive days. It's a generous gift to commemorate the occasion!

Three popular gold-tier fighters—Lizard Jade, Edenian Blood Sindel, and Klassic Smoke—are now eligible for ascension, offering deeper customization and power progression opportunities.
